100k challenge: To be achieved before August 2013

Hi everyone thanks for clicking on my thread. As the thread title explains my challenge is to have a net worth of £100,000 by the 29th July 2013. If I achieve this goal I will have enough money for a deposit for my dream house in the UK. This total is ambitious but definitely within reach if I save very hard. I am currently working in Australia and will be until my visa expires in July 2013, I am 21.

I currently have 5k invested in the stock market (lost 10k last year, ouch!) and 4k in cash, I own a car but it is probably worth 10 pence lol:D. No debt. I intend to put all money earned into a saver account which is paying 5.75%.

My main challenge is to find employment when my current contract finishes in about 6 months time. I expect I will be out of work for 4 weeks, any longer would start to hurt my chances of achieving my goal so this will be the most important time of the whole challenge for me!

Hopefully this journal will help me reach my goal, there are so many inspirational posts and people on here I believe with the help and support of you guys anything is possible, In return I hope I can help others achieve their goals. :)
